Damages

As the biggest trucks on the road, 18 wheelers carry large amounts of cargo. This includes hazardous substances such as gasoline, ethanol, chemicals, and radioactive materials. These substances are at a high risk for causing serious injuries and fatalities in a crash, especially when they spill or roll over.

The consequences of an accident involving an 18 wheeler can be quite severe. Medical bills, lost wages and suffering and pain are only some of the damages that can be sustained. Your case's value will be determined by the severity of your injuries and the financial loss you suffer.

In certain instances, multiple parties could be accountable for the incident. For instance, the employer of a truck driver may be held accountable for failing to ensure that their employees were adequately skilled or properly trained for their work. In addition, a trucking company could be held accountable for the carelessness of its vehicles.

In some instances components made by a component maker or repair shop might be held responsible for an accident. If the cargo was not properly stacked or weighed and weighed, the shipping company may also be held liable. Our team will look into all potential accountable parties to help get the most money for your losses. To calculate the full extent your injuries, we will take into consideration past, current, and future medical expenses. Our legal experts can assist you in recovering the expenses related to any property damage that occurred as a result of your accident.

Suffering and pain

18-wheeler accidents can cause serious injuries that can change your life. As such, their victims can expect to pay for a significant amount of damages, including medical costs as well as loss of wages. Accident victims of trucks can receive compensation for pain and discomfort. These non-economic damages cover the emotional, physical, and mental distress that the victim experiences. They may include a disfigurement loss of enjoyment of life, and other psychological issues.
